Mediterrania’s exits in the last 12 months:

TGCC -> IPOIn December 2021, Mediterrania announced its partial exit of TGCC, the national leader in the construction industry in Morocco, through an IPO in the Casablanca Stock Exchange (CSE). With a one-week subscription period, the IPO was significantly oversubscribed and enabled the largest-ever Private Equity exit in the CSE.

Groupe Cofina -> Secondary saleFour years after Mediterrania invested in Groupe Cofina, the leading mesofinance and transactional financial services institution in West and Central Africa, it sold its stake to a Private Equity group based in London in May 2022. During Mediterrania’s tenure, Cofina implemented a growth strategy focused on developing financing solutions to support SMEs in their development. The group also launched mobile and web-based banking applications enabling customers to perform financial transactions from their mobile phones, tablets and computers.

Groupe Scolaire René Descartes -> MBOIn November 2022, Mediterrania exited Groupe Scolaire René Descartes (GSRD), the leading international education programme provider in Tunisia, through an MBO led by GSRD’s management. “Thanks to Mediterrania, we quickly moved from a family entity to a large-scale education group, becoming the market leader in Tunisia,” said Mrs Dhouha Sellaoui, Founder of Groupe Scolaire René Descartes.

MedTech -> MBOIn November 2022, Mediterrania sold its stake in MedTech, Morocco’s leading IT and telecom services integrator. Under Mediterrania’s tenure, MedTech achieved significant social improvements, including 50% employment growth and increased female employment amounting to over a third of the group’s total workforce. Mediterrania’s exit from MedTech was executed through an MBO led by the management team.

Indigo Company -> MBO + Secondary saleIn November 2022, Mediterrania sold its stake in Cap Retail, Indigo’s subsidiary in Morocco, through an MBO led by Cap Retails’ management and backed by Valoris Capital, a Moroccan Private Equity firm.

Akdital Group -> IPOAkdital Group, the largest private clinics group in Morocco, is launching an IPO at the Casablanca Stock Exchange in mid-December 2022 enabling Mediterrania’s partial exit from the company. The capital increase will support Akdital’s geographical and medical services expansion maintaining the fast pace set during Mediterrania’s 3-year tenure.

About Mediterrania Capital Partners

Founded in 2013, Mediterrania Capital Partners is a Private Equity firm focusing on growth investments in SMEs and mid-cap companies in Africa. The firm invests in consolidated and growing companies with an annual turnover of €20 million to €300 million and expansion strategies into North and Sub-Saharan African markets.

Headquartered in Valletta and with offices in Abidjan, Barcelona, Cairo, Casablanca and Mauritius, the company takes a proactive, hands-on approach to implementing the growth strategy of its portfolio companies by driving their Value Creation and ESG processes.

Mediterrania Capital Partners is a regulated financial investment manager licensed by the Malta Financial Services Authority (MFSA), the Financial Services Commission (FSC) in Mauritius and the Comisión Nacional del Mercado de Valores (CNMV) in Spain.
